A three star hotel on Mararo Avenue in Greater Nairobi, with free wifi, free parking and multilingual staff. What decides it is the car: this is a quarter built for driving, not for walking out of an evening.
01What it is
Mararo Court lists three things and no more: free wifi, free car parking and multilingual staff. The parking is the one a visitor will care about most, because this part of the city is built around the car and around the conference room. Free wifi covers the working evening. Multilingual staff matter if you are arriving without much English or Swahili. That is the whole list, and it is thin: nothing here says breakfast, nothing says a gym, nothing says a shuttle or a restaurant, so plan on the hotel doing the basics and the rest of the day happening elsewhere.
What that adds up to is a plain three star property for someone whose day is already organised around a car and a meeting, and who wants the room to be simple, connected and easy to park at. Mararo Court makes sense if you are driving in from Greater Nairobi, if you are here on business and leaving early, or if you simply want somewhere quiet to sleep away from the centre. It does not suit anyone hoping to step out of the lobby into an evening: the street is new concrete on a ridge, and after dark it is safe and dull, hotel bars, and a ride anywhere else.

04Standing outside the ten quarters
These hotels are not in Upper Hill and Community, and they are not in any of the ten quarters of the centre this site covers. They sit well outside the centre, in the inner suburbs, and Upper Hill and Community is only the nearest of the ten quarters. That matters more than it sounds: you are staying in the wider city, and anything in the CBD means travelling in and out for it. The ridge itself is new concrete built for the car and the conference room, and most of the CBD's office space has been moving up there since the 2000s, which is why you find the tallest towers in the country, the big hospitals, the aid agencies and an expressway ramp to the airport on it. The quarter sits 1.9 km from Kenyatta Avenue at Moi Avenue, which is 24 minutes on foot in a direct line.
Upper Hill and Community is best for meetings, a quiet night close in, and a fast run to the airport. After dark it is safe and dull: hotel bars, and a ride anywhere else. If you want the centre on foot, this is not the right base.

06Questions
Where exactly is Mararo Court?+
It stands on Mararo Avenue in Greater Nairobi, away from the office core rather than in it. For scale, it is 6.66 km from Kenyatta Avenue at Moi Avenue, which is 84 minutes on foot in a direct line.
How close is it to the quarter this site covers?+
Mararo Court is 5.12 km from Upper Hill and Community, which is the nearest of the ten quarters this site covers. That puts it outside the centre, so think of it as a Greater Nairobi base reached by car rather than a place you walk from.
What does the hotel actually provide?+
The listed facilities are free wifi, free car parking and multilingual staff. There is no restaurant, gym or shuttle on the list, so treat Mararo Court as a place to sleep and work and plan your meals and meetings elsewhere.
